We never knew this place was here even though it’s in the business district, it’s right on the outskirts between the municipal buildings and the boat docks. It was tough to find a parking spot nearby, but I’m glad we got one about two blocks away. We needed the exercise after our meal here. It’s a converted residence, so the inside is small, but out back are several patios and a large courtyard. Some of the tables have upholstered chairs, some canvas, some metal, and an overall eclectic but comfortable atmosphere, The next thing we noticed was that many of the tables had dogs quietly sitting under them. This is very pet friendly. Our server was Tonya, and she was nothing short of fantastic. She treated us like long lost friends. Oh yeah, might as well mention the food. It’s geared to Jamaican style fare. My daughter got the jerk burger and it had to be about 6″ high.(see one of the attached photos) No way a human can get their mouth around it! Two of us had pub burgers which were normal size, and I got jerk pork with sweet potato fries and slaw. It was all tasty and well seasoned. If you’re not into authentic jerk style, it may be a bit much, but we loved every bite. We will be back!!!
